Mistake 3: Not Checking RERA & Legal Clearances

Most buyers assume a project is RERA compliant — but:

  • some phases aren’t registered
  • approvals may be partial
  • land titles may be unclear
  • environmental clearances may be pending
  • construction licenses may vary

✔ Correct Approach

Before investing, verify:

  • RERA registration number
  • legal land ownership
  • license validity
  • approved layout plans
  • environmental clearance
  • occupancy certificate timeline

This prevents future disputes.

Mistake 7: Misunderstanding the Price Appreciation Potential of Different Zones

Different zones grow for different reasons.

Example:

  • GCR → saturated luxury
  • GCER → lifestyle-driven
  • New Gurgaon → infrastructure-driven
  • Sohna Road → mid-premium affordability
  • Cyber City → commercial stability

Not knowing micro-market behavior is a big mistake.

✔ Correct Approach

Analyze long-term potential:

ZoneKey DriverAppreciation Potential
Sector 99–113Expressway + metro⭐⭐⭐⭐⭐
GCERlifestyle + premium launches⭐⭐⭐⭐
Sohna Roadaffordability + improving infra⭐⭐⭐
MG Roadcommercial rentals⭐⭐
Cyber Cityoffice rentals⭐⭐⭐
